Very little is
known about the leader of the Death Corps beyond
his past. Inducted into the I.M.S.R.D. at an
early age, he quickly took to mech combat,
especially melee. He learned quickly and achieved
some of the institutes highest scores. He
soon became known for his high kill ratio and
long record of misconduct. A loose cannon by
nature, he usually seemed fairly friendly,
reckless, and always ready for a challenge.
Toward the end of his time at the I.M.S.R.D., in
the year 140 U.E., he had become more aloof and
distant, avoiding classmates who had once been
close friends. He spent much more time working on
his mech, which will be discussed in more detail
later. He also had a love for bladed weapons that
bordered obsession, and soon became evident
through his mechs many blades.
Within the same week of the formation of the
Galactic Police, an accident occurred aboard a
ship that had been transporting Dyson and his
comrades to their next mission. According to
reports, a reactor error occurred aboard the ship.
It began to go critical and Dyson reacted quickly
moving all aboard to the escape shuttles or their
mechs. According to some of his classmates, of
the I.M.S.R.D. Elites aboard, Dyson
and a close friend of his were the last aboard.
Dyson launched from the ship moments before his
comrade... and the ships explosion. Much of
the crew was killed in the blast, and Dyson was
heard shouting in rage as he watched the wreckage
of his friends mech hurtle into space. At this
time he flew off away from his comrades. He has
not been seen by any member of the I.M.S.R.D.
since. It also remains a refuted subject as to
whether the reactor error was accident or
sabotage...
He re-emerged in the year 142 U.E., bearing his
powerful, completed mecha, the Shruiken4, and
heading the powerful, and well-organized criminal
organization now known as the Death Corps. The
group quickly began to wreck havoc across the
galaxy, attacking, raiding, and stealing from
vessels and colonies. To avoid a damaged economy,
among other personal interests, the Mars Unified
Nation signed a treaty with the Death Corps and
provided them with powerful mecha. In the end
this caused further trouble for Mars as Earth
discovered the contract.
In the year 143 U.E., the Mars Unified Nation and
the Earth Sphere Alliance called for a hearing.
Fearing that not only may this foul up their
attempts, but cause a collaboration on the two
nations parts to get rid of them, Dyson ordered
an assassinations of Earth representative Gruna
and Mars president Delar. However, the Death
Corps assassin assigned to the job only partially
completed his mission, and president Delar lived.
But in the end it proved to work out better then
Dyson could have ever hoped: Earth blamed mars
for the incident. On February 1st of that year,
war broke out between the two nations. And the
Death Corps began to put their own plans into
action, using the war to conceal their attacks
upon Earth and Mars transports. Soon they would
be ready... and then the war would begin in
earnest.
The Shuriken4 is truly a revolutionary new mech
made personally by Dyson himself, showing his
great--if demented--genius in weapons technology.
The ship has a powerful new reactor that gives it
great power, and engines that give it unsurpassed
speed. With smaller jets arranged strategically
on various parts of its body, it can
maneuver beautifully, reversing direction within
a second and pulling daredevil maneuvers that
only those with nothing to lose--or the insane--would
ever attempt, especially in the atmosphere. Its
surface is literally bristling with blades, from
wrists, to knuckles, to knees, to wings. Its
armor is made from a powerful steel, but
manufactured in such a way, that despite its
light appearance, offers unusually strong
protection. For primary weapons, it carries a
standard 105mm gun pod, a laser rifle, a dual
barrel beam cannon, a missile pod on each
shoulder containing 10 HM (High Maneuver)
missiles in each, two beam sabers (may be joined
together at the butt), a twin beam spear
affectionately called the Shield Breaker--and
with good reason-- and twin double barrel vulcan
machine cannons mounted on its head. It
also has a shield mounted on the backside of its
left arm in the traditional style. It can change
into two other modes--guardian, which is a sort
of in-between mode used for quick changes in
direction or velocity, and jet mode--which it may
change to. It also has standard sensor jamming
for covert uses.
Dyson himself usually carries an immaculately
crafted longsword he calls Isileth or Widowmaker,
and a beautiful spear adorned with a dragon,
called Ykraith. He usually has a beam saber
hidden in each boot, and may have any number of
bladed weapons hidden on his person at any time... He also often
carries a pair of Desert Eagle .45 modified semi-auto
magnums.
